- 🏜️ Scenic highlights — every stop earns its place:
- Tianchi Lake (D2): Heavenly Lake of the Tianshan — alpine lake at 1,900m, surrounded by snow-capped peaks. A gentle warm-up for the journey ahead.
- Sayram Lake (D3-D4): Xinjiang's most beautiful alpine lake, full VIP loop — Swan Lake, Songshutou, Kelayongzhu. Stay at the east gate hotel, enjoy sunset and sunrise over the lake.
- Kuerdun or Nalati (D5): Choose between Kuerdun's spruce forests or Nalati's rolling grasslands — both with VIP drive-in, no shuttle queues. The driver takes you to the best viewpoints.
- Kashgar Old City (D6-D7): A full day exploring the living Silk Road city — the opening ceremony at the city gate, the Fragrant Concubine Park (Apak Hoja Mausoleum), the Id Kah Mosque, and the century-old teahouse. No schedule, no rushing.
- Pamir Plateau (D8-D9): White Sand Lake's turquoise water, Karakul Lake mirroring the 7,546m Muztagh Ata glacier, Dragon Road's 600 bends, and Bandir Blue Lake. Overnight in Tashkurgan with oxygen supply — comfortable even at 3,100m. (If Dragon Road is closed, alternative visit to Golden Grassland and Stone Fort.)
